I'm an American citizen. Can I get a Visa when I arrive in Shanghai by sailboat or do I need to get it before?

Is there anchorage for sailboats? Where can I get information on anchorage for sailboats in SH?

If your stay in SH is longer than 24 hours, you need to apply for a Chinese visa in advance. If for a short visit within 24 hours, you are exempted from visa.
